Balfour Beatty Utility Solutions faced rising maintenance costs and the risk of running a business-critical product design system on a proprietary DEC VAX/OpenVMS platform. To address this, Balfour Beatty worked with Advanced on an OpenVMS application migration project to move the bespoke design suite to a more flexible Windows environment.
Advanced first carried out a PathFinder assessment, then used its migration toolset to automate most of the ALGOL and Fortran code migration to Windows Server 2003. The project was delivered to a fixed budget, required no user retraining, and helped Balfour Beatty reduce costs, lower risk, and continue improving the system with an increasing return on investment.
